迅睿CMS框架是一款PHP8高性能·简单易用的CMS开源开发框架,基于MIT开源许可协议发布,免费且不限制商业使用,是免费开源的产品,以万端互联为设计理念,支持的微信公众号、小程序、APP客户端、移动端网站、PC网站等多终端式管理系统。
联系官方销售客服
1835022288
028-61286886
老大,数据库操作,当记录的日期跟当前日期差距大于30天的时候,删除该数据,要怎么写?
捣鼓好久没成功,MYSQL运行成功了,在PHP里写却怎么都没法运行
麻烦指点一下
还要加个条件,用户id 等于当前用户
\Phpcmf\Service::M()->query("SQL语句");
\Phpcmf\Service::M()->db->table($this->tablename.'_表名')->where('uid='.$this->uid.' AND '.DateDiff(时间,inputtime))>30))->delete();
\Phpcmf\Service::M()->db->table($this->tablename.'_表名')->where('uid='.$this->uid.' AND DateDiff(时间,inputtime))>30')->delete();
\Phpcmf\Service::M()->db->table($this->tablename.'_footprint')->where('uid='.$this->uid)->where('DATEDIFF("2020-10-10",from_unixtime(inputtime))>30')->delete();